Damned and shunted: Inspector removed for turning away Muslims from dam sit


Police Inspector B M Rajvanshi, who was posted at the Sardar Sarovar dam site, was transferred to the Rajpipla Local Crime Bureau (LCB) on Thursday.

The transfer comes a day after The Indian Express reported that the security personnel at the site were turning away Muslim tourists in view of the security threat. Narmada Superintendent of Police Khurshid Ahmed said, "Rajvanshi has been transferred to the Rajpipla LCB."

Some fire-fighting with a feeble force


City fire service department ill-equipped to face natural challenges due to dated equipment, manpower shortage

The city, during its recent tryst with terror emerged with flying colours, but the blues of the blue-uniformed force, the Ahmedabad Fire and Emergency Service (AFES), are far from over. It finds itself ill-equipped to meet the challenges thrown up during monsoon.

Modi’s blue-eyed MLA faces arrest in land-grab case


HC orders arrest of Jamnadas Patel for acquiring land worth Rs 15 cr in connivance with govt officials

The noose is tightening around Chief Minister Narendra Modi's close associate and Bharatiya Janata Party MLA from Dascroi, Babu Jamnadas Patel. The Gujarat High Court has asked the Sarkhej police to register an FIR against the legislator and conduct investigations into a land grabbing case.
